Large and Powerful
" I have used this this motor for about a year now in my Emerald Night train.
More than plenty pulling power with the gear ratio assigned to the train.
Only one problem: this great motor reguires a rather large locomotive-body to fit, othervise, FANTASTIC !!
For smaller train builds, you can with great success use the smaller 8883 M-motor.
This motor can pull the Emerald Night with the coach for about 3 hours on a fully charged 8878 rechargable battery box.
So far no problems, I expect this motor to have a long and rewarding play-life for years to come. "

Not enough POWER ??
" After having my Emerald Night for about a year now, I wanted to make a MOC steam locomotive.
The 8882 XL-motor has more than plenty power for trains, but it's a bit bulky and requires a rather large loco body to be built into.
The XL-motor can pull a train for about 3 hours on a fully charged 8878 rechargable battery box.
I bought a brand new 8883 M-motor and mounted it in a wheel and gear setup similar to the Emerald Night.
It runs great for almost 2 hours pulling 2 coaches, but the motor gets very warm.
After cooling for about 15 minutes the motor is ready again.
If used with RC , changing direction and stops will give you about 5 hours of running power on a fully charged 8878.
NOT BAD AT ALL !!
Reading the other reviews of this motor, I'm prepared that I might actually wear this motor out, and change it after a while,
but so far, after running trains for more than 20 hours on this motor, no problems yet.
Plenty power for it's size, and fantastic for trains and other power functions.
The size of this motor makes it perfect for fitting into (smaller) trains.

1 year late review
" I've had this amazing set including the power functions add-on for about a year now.
Definitely a SERIOUS model, working connecting rods and pistons.
The dark green color scheme makes it look VERY BRITISH, or at least very european.
I have made a few mods: extending the technic drive shaft and adding 2 more 12 tooth gears giving power to one more axle.
This makes the engine run more smoothly.
Another mod was changing the wheel technic studs to real 6L axles, othervise the short axle studs might get stuck and roll badly.
The locomotive can even be mounted with the smaller 8883 power functions motor, but it gets rather warm after running the train for more than 1 hour at a time.
On the other hand, that wil give you power to run the train for about 5 hours with the 8878 rechargable battery, where as the large 8882 will run for about 3 hours on a charge.
Another easy mod is covering up the battery box in the tender.
This brilliant locomotive has inspired me and many others to build more realistic steam engines than before.
The coach is beautifully made, but is rather small compared to the the massive locomotive.
I wish lego made and sold separate coaches to upgrade this fantastic set.
There has been good lego train sets made since, including the astonishing Maersk train, but please make more steam locomotives. "

Absolutely Amazing
" When lego came out with the "Santa Fe" that was the beginning of lego trains taking a turn towards (almost) realistic model trains.
The Emerald Night was no exception either, and now the Maersk container train is another eye-pleaser.
Both locomotive, containers, container cars and the truck are fantastic detailed models.
It took a whole evening to put it together because of the MANY bags labeled "1" (for the locomotive).
It was rather difficult to find the parts needed since they are located in many different bags.
Same when putting the containers, container cars and the truck together.
This time, LOTS of bags labeled "2" , and finding pieces for each build was difficult for these units as well.
LOTS OF STICKERS !! .... I really hope lego will PRINT on bricks in the future.
When stickers cover multiple bricks, you can't take the model apart for other builds without damaging the stickers permantly.
My set had 1 part missing. One frame for a set of train (wagon) wheels was missing, and there was 1 EXTRA box/package with 4 axles.
This is actually the first time I have bought a set where count wasn't perfect, luckyly I have spares, and the train was running shortly after.
Power functions 8884 , 88002 and 88000 was added, and the train runs great and looks absolutely astonishing.
This is IMO the best looking lego train produced so far, too bad that you cant instantly add lights to the locomotive as easy as on the 7839.
I hope that lego wil produce an additional set including more containercars WITH containers, and a container forklift.
That would be AVESOME !!

The "Main Knob" for all IR builds
" This unit is brilliant !!
It's not just a reciever, but also a twin controller unit.
It has 2 separate subchannels for each of the 4 main channels.
This way it will control 2 motors or 1 motor and lights on a train, or any two powerfunction units.
As a "train-o-holic" this unit along with the other controls is a MUST for powering and controlling modern lego IR trains.
I wish that lego would make a SET with the necessary items for powering trains:
8884 IR reciever
8879 IR speed remote control
8870 lights
88002 train motor
88000 battery box (or alternately, 8878 rechargable battery box and 8887 charger)
And then give us a reasonable rebate on the whole deal, since we already have bought a train. {;o) "

Very versatile power supply
" In the beginning this fine little battery box wasn't sold separately, but only came in the 7938 and 7939 train sets.
Now it's available by itself, and will be used widely for trains and power functions.
I have 2 of these, one from 7939 and one waiting for my 10219 Maersk train.
The smal size is great, and the on/off switch with green indicator light and polarity switch makes it extremely versatile for just about any lego build needing electric power.
If, and only if you use it a lot, and change batteries constantly, I would recommend the 8878 rechargable battery box.
Even though the 8878 is so much more expensive, it will be cheaper to operate in the long run.
I still use my first 8878 that came with my Emerald night, and it will let you run trains longer on a charge than a 88000 with a fresh set of batteries.

Excellent, expensive, but well worth buying !!
" Fantastic looking engine, could be any modern european electric freight train engine.
Details are good, and the "hidden" on/off battery switch is cleverly made.
The RC works fine even though the reciever is located rather low in the loco body.
Train motor has plenty pulling power for even more rolling stock added to the train,
and it runs for about 2 hours on the 6 small AAA batteries.
However I would recomend getting the 8878 rechargeable battery box.
8878 is VERY expensive, but i have used one since the Emerald Night,
and it will eventually save you batteries and money after a while.
Also the 8878 will keep this train running for 3 to 4 hours.
For more fun, get the 8870 light set, it fits in the loco without modifications.
The tanker and the container cars are made without a train baseplate, VERY COOL.
The car transporter is average but with 2 cool cars, looks like Smartcar and a modern Fiat 500.
2 containers that fit on traincars, and on the trucks trailer.
Well detailed container crane, a bit useless for lifting since cars and containers will spin on the single wire.
Great looking, but medium detailed truck with trailer for containers.
Finally TRACKS, this set contains a good layout for starters, including 2 switck tracks and some of the cool new flexible tracks.
pros: EVERYTHING .... except ....
cons: I really would prefer real traindoors og no traindoors in the loco.
the "flip-front" is better suited for futuristic cars og spacecrafts.
On the other hand, these trainfronts look fantastic as long as they are kept down. {;o)

Finally !!
" After a Loooong wait, the 8879 remote arrived.
I ordered the Night Emerald and power functions set on April 2. 2009.
I recieved the train and extra flex-tracks on June 9. 2009.
Finally the remote arrived on August 14. 2009.
Now the train can be controlled properly !!
4 chanel IR remote with 2 functions per chanel.
Chanel is selected on the orange slide in the middle,
letting you pick chanel 1, 2, 3 or 4.
The chanel number you chose should be the same as
the chanel slide on the 8884 IR reciever brick.
Each function has a jogwheel for power control,
forward or reverse depending on which way you turn the dial.
The Night Emerald use 1 function for lights,
and 1 for motor control.
There is also an emergency stop (red botton)
and a reverse/invert switch (small black slide switch)
Now it's possible to run the train on any of the 4 chanels,
and unlike the 8885 remote, the train maintains speed
and lights when you let go the controls.
Finally it was worth waiting for, and it might be useful
with other power functions because this remote lets your
model maintain speeds when not handeled. {;o)
Now we just wait for more awesome trains to follow the Night Emerald. !!! . {;o) "

Great technology
" This power unit can run my Emerald Night for well over 3hours.
However the price is VERY expensive, but hopefully it will last for a long time, earning it's keep by saving bundles of batteries, and eventually money !!
It's a fine unit, lightweight, packing lots of long lasting power.
While waiting for my 8879 remote, the train motor runs directly on the rechargeable box using the orange regulator and grey on/off switch for running the train.
{;o) "
